Why Soil Testing Matters: Clarity in the Dirt

Plants speak their minds through color, shape, and vitality. Pale leaves, stalled growth, and weak stems signal an imbalance beneath the surface, often due to issues with nutrients, pH, or structure.

Here's the kicker—guessing won't save you. Soil testing delivers precise measurements, guiding your gardening decisions with confidence and clarity.

Soil pH: The Invisible Game Maker

One spring, my blue hydrangeas stubbornly bloomed pink. Frustrated, I checked my soil pH to find it lurking above 7.0 (too alkaline)—the kiss of death to blue blooms.

Understanding your garden's pH unlocks plant success; most flowers thrive at a slightly acidic 6.0–6.5, but veggies typically enjoy a neutral pH around 6.5–7.0.

Essential Nutrients: Know What's Missing or Too Generous

A test report keeps guesswork at bay, pinpointing exactly what nutrients your soil lacks or generously hoards. Nitrogen (N), phosphorus (P), and potassium (K)—the big three—impact everything from root strength to fruit size.

"Over 50% of gardening problems stem directly from improper soil nutrition." — National Extension Service Survey

Once, my soil had excessive phosphorus, locking out key micronutrients like iron and zinc. Leaves yellowed, yields suffered badly, and no amount of fertilizer cured my woes.

Organic Matter: The Lifeblood in Your Beds

Testing reports also reveal organic matter content, which shapes soil structure, moisture retention, and microbial life. Ideal levels hover between 3%–6%; less than that, and your soil dries hard as concrete in the July sun (around 90°F or 32°C).

Adding compost—generously—raised my organic content significantly, transforming sticky clay into porous, fertile magic and restoring my gardening pride.

Taking the Test: Easy Steps for Accurate Results

Thankfully, gathering soil samples isn't rocket science. Follow these simple steps:

  1. Pick several random spots from around your garden bed.
  2. Use a clean trowel to collect small samples, each about 6 inches (15 cm) deep.
  3. Mix them together in a clean bucket, forming a representative composite sample.
  4. Fill your test bag (provided by a local extension office or gardening center) with the mixed soil.

Send the sample to your area's agricultural university or a trusted local lab. Within days, you’ll receive detailed results and fertilizer recommendations tailored to your unique patch of earth.

Frequently Asked Questions About Soil Testing

How often should gardeners perform soil testing?

Performing a detailed soil test every two to three years gives gardeners reliable information for maintaining ideal growing conditions. If crop performance noticeably decreases or soil amendments occur frequently, annual testing may provide additional assistance.

What's the ideal time of year to conduct soil testing?

For accurate results, aim to conduct your soil testing early in spring or late in autumn. Cooler temperatures between 50°F to 70°F (10°C to 21°C) and consistent moisture levels offer optimal sampling conditions.

How deep should soil samples be taken for testing?

For most vegetables, flowers, and lawns, collect soil samples from approximately 6 inches (15 centimeters) deep. Trees and shrubs require deeper sampling, typically around 12 to 18 inches (30 to 45 centimeters) to reflect their rooting depth.

How many soil samples should gardeners collect for accurate results?

Gathering multiple soil samples, usually 10 to 15 per 1,000 square feet (approximately 100 square meters), and thoroughly mixing them creates a representative sample. This method provides a complete picture of your garden's soil health.

Can home test kits replace laboratory soil analyses?

Although home soil testing kits offer convenient results for basic pH levels and nutrients like nitrogen, phosphorus, and potassium, a certified laboratory analysis supplies comprehensive reports on organic matter, micronutrients, and accurate amendment recommendations.

What's the best way to store soil samples before submission?

Store collected soil samples in clean, labeled containers at room temperature until submission. Avoid sealed plastic bags or wet containers, as improper storage may alter test results.

What key nutrients commonly measured in soil testing enhance plant growth?

Essential nutrients commonly evaluated include nitrogen, phosphorus, and potassium—often abbreviated as N-P-K—alongside secondary nutrients such as calcium, magnesium, and sulfur. Micronutrients like iron, zinc, copper, and manganese also have significant effects on plant vitality and should be considered in comprehensive lab tests.

After testing, how should gardeners interpret the results?

A professional lab usually provides detailed guidelines alongside results, listing recommended soil amendments to correct imbalances. Follow their prescribed instructions carefully, adjusting soil pH or nutrient levels gradually for best outcomes.
